A brief summary of Fartown in West Yorkshire
Fartown is a settlement located in West Yorkshire, England.
Property prices in Fartown show an average sale price of £244,132, based on 50 recent transactions recorded by HM Land Registry.
There were no crimes reported in the immediate area during the most recent reporting period. This makes Fartown a particularly low-crime area.
Fartown has 4 conservation areas within its boundaries: Greenhead Park, Huddersfield Town Centre, Birkby, Edgerton. Planning applications within or near these conservation areas are subject to additional scrutiny to preserve the architectural and historic character of the area. Homeowners and developers should be aware that permitted development rights may be restricted.
Ecology & Nature Designations
The area around Fartown includes 5 Ancient Woodland sites. These designations may affect planning decisions, as proposals near protected sites require environmental impact assessment and may face additional restrictions.

Planning Activity in Fartown
In the last 24 months, 39 planning applications were submitted near Fartown. Of these, 100% were approved, with an average decision time of 60 days.
This is notably above the national average of approximately 87%, suggesting a relatively permissive planning environment. Applicants near Fartown may find that well-prepared applications have a strong chance of success.
At 60 days on average, decisions near Fartown slightly exceed the 8-week statutory target for minor applications, though this is common across many councils.
The most common application types near Fartown were full planning applications (19), tree works (10), discharge of conditions (3). Full planning applications account for 49% of all submissions, covering new builds, change of use, and works that go beyond permitted development rights.
1 planning appeal was lodged, of which 0 were allowed and 1 was dismissed (0% success rate). This low success rate indicates that the council's refusal decisions are generally upheld by the Planning Inspectorate.
